Keeping a Server Automation Plan running for complete automation of Task

We are trying to leverage the IEM Server Automation Plans when building new VM servers by having newly deployed servers register themselves in a custom new server site and group. This is done by relevance that looks for a specific registry key on the server. After that happens we would like the Server Automation Plan to kick off and run several baselines on the servers as well as a couple of other automation plan steps. When it is all done, it removes the key and the servers fall out of that dynamic group and site. All works fine when I manually run the automation plan but when the servers are done, the plan stops even though I set the stop time for weeks later than the start and the plan does not run on new servers that pop up in the site and group. Is it possible to keep the plan running so that anytime servers check in under this process it runs on them and I don’t have to take action and schedule the automation plan each time?

Hey @tbooker - unfortunately no, that is not really possible right now. Automation plans do not work like regular policy actions, which I think is more along the lines of what you’re thinking.
